What do you recommend I change next?

First time building a PC on a very tight budget.
I spent $40 on the tower which included the CPU, RAM, Motherboard, and Optical Drive you see in there. I spent like $160 on the 1050ti, and $30 on the hard drive.
I've heard the Pentium g4650 is a very decent budget processor, but is it compatible with the motherboard? Am I better off changing both at the same time?

I get good fps in games and have only dipped below 60 when playing Skyrim loaded with mods.
6 posts and 1 images submitted.
>>
Look into motherboard sockets, chipsets and other interfaces.
You will not be able to put a Pentium G4560 on that motherboard.

You need an LGA 1151 socket motherboard with a compatible chipset. H110 can do it but requires a bios update, so you'd be better off buying a B250 motherboard.

If you were to upgrade to a Pentium g4560 you would also require DDR4 ram, thats not a recommendation, lga 1151 boards only have ddr4 dimm slots

If youre looking for a CPU upgrade next, youre going to have to look into a new motherboard too. Lga 1156 is pretty outdated at this point and even the high end processors from that time are old as balls.

If you want to save a bit of money on a cpu and motherboard upgrade by not having to buy DDR4 ram, you can go LGA 1150 and still use DDR3, but get something like an i5 4460, which will be a very good processor upgrade for around 100$ used

Will a MicroATX motherboard fit over Mini ITX holes?
Biostar has a few of these boards that are 6.7" mini ITX but with two PCIe slots, giving it a bit of extra length. But its still 6.7" lengthwise.
They have an AM1 one im interested in and an LGA 1150 one too. Im thinking single slot gpu + pcie SSD in a mini itx case like a Cooler Master Elite 110.
In that case id go for Lga 1150 over AM1 due to pci lanes obviously.
>>
>>59886349
That's a mini-DTX board that you're talking about. Yes, it should fit into most 2 slot ITX cases.

The only problem is that you won't be able to use dual slot graphics cards unless if you enjoy getting bottlenecked by the 1x PCIe slot and not be able to use the 16x PCIe slot at all. Kinda negates the entire purpose.
